Yes, by todays standards, they are slow but you have to remember that 20 yrs. ago a high to mid 14 second car was quick and a 5.0 mustang was the cheapest car you could buy to go that quick. A new 5.0 mustang back then would only cost you about $14,000. That was cheap!

It would not take too much to beat your dad's '07 GT, which only runs mid 13's stock.
You say 14's are slow...but even mid 13's are slow by today standards.
I am NOT impressed with the new mustangs. Ford added power over the years but also increased weight.

Originally Posted by notsoslo5.0
whats a good rmp to launch at on street tires?
I've only been to one track but I've been down it about 100 times.
That track had worse traction then the street for the first 60ft. Maybe the combination of left over chemicals and rubber does not work well with street tires. With my stock GT with 2.73 gears, launching at 2000 rpm and feathering the gas until about 20 seemed the best. 2.73s are a little tricky though as it is very easy to bog down if you don't spin. Spinning street tires to heat them is pretty much useless, a little to clean off any stray water or debris but any more then that is a waste. I see people doing it all the time but it never helped me any.
